Former Omaha Hockey senior forward Samuel Huo signed an Amateur Tryout Deal with the Tahoe Knight Monsters of the ECHL, according to an April 2 announcement. The contract was upgraded to a standard player contract on March 20, and Huo has since played in eight games for the team.
The move marks a significant step in Huo’s career as he transitions from college hockey to professional play. The Tahoe Knight Monsters are affiliated with the National Hockey League’s Vegas Golden Knights.
Huo scored his first professional goal during his eighth game with Tahoe. During his single season at Omaha, he played in 30 games and recorded seven goals and nine assists for a total of 16 points.
Omaha head coach Mike Gabinet said, “It was great having Sam join us for his senior season. We wish him all the best as he transitions into his pro career.”
